Description: This is a new program funded by the National Science Foundation Division of Materials Research with additional support from Case. Pending the availability of funding, the program will support a research program for eight to ten undergraduates from outside Case. Each student will be mentored by a physics faculty member on an individual research project designed especially for an undergraduate. In addition to being engaged in individual research, REU students will participate in weekly discussion meetings, professional skills development workshops, a workshop on ethical issues in science, an end-of-the-summer poster symposium, and other professional and social networking activities for undergraduate summer researchers.
